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Do rollovers or trading hour templ. affect backtest results?

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Do rollovers or trading hour templ. affect backtest results?

    My friend and I were both testing a strategy on MCL, and have records of the backtest results from our optimizations. the next week we revisited our strategies to get updated data, and the results are different, including a new larger drawdown between March 2023 and October 2023. We both get the same huge drawdown that we weren't getting before. In the intervening period we both did the MCL 04-25 rollover and updated the trading hour templates. Can either of these updates introduce the 2023 drawdown?

    #2
    Hello Ndakotan1313,


    Thank you for posting on the NinjaTrader forums.


    Based on your description, there are two main changes that could have affected your backtest results:


    1. MCL 04-25 Rollover

    When rolling over futures contracts, NinjaTrader merges data from the expiring contract into the new contract based on the Merge Policy set in the platform.
    • Possible Issue: If the Merge Policy changed (e.g., from "Do Not Merge" to "Merge Back Adjusted"), historical price levels may have been adjusted, altering backtest results.
    • Check: You can confirm this by setting your Merge Policy to "Do Not Merge" and re-running the backtest.


    2. Updated Trading Hours Templates

    If the Trading Hours template for MCL changed (e.g., new session times or holidays), historical bars may be built differently, affecting entry/exit logic.
    • Possible Issue: If a backtest previously ran on a different session template (e.g., "Default 24x7" vs. "CME Energy RTH"), orders could have executed at different times or been skipped entirely.
    • Check: Compare the Trading Hours templates used in both backtests. You can do this in Tools > Trading Hours and ensure they match.



    Thank you in advance!

    Comment

    Latest Posts

    Collapse

    Topics Statistics Last Post
    Started by argusthome, 03-08-2026, 10:06 AM
    0 responses
    60 views
    0 likes
    Last Post argusthome  
    Started by NabilKhattabi, 03-06-2026, 11:18 AM
    0 responses
    39 views
    0 likes
    Last Post NabilKhattabi  
    Started by Deep42, 03-06-2026, 12:28 AM
    0 responses
    21 views
    0 likes
    Last Post Deep42
    by Deep42
     
    Started by TheRealMorford, 03-05-2026, 06:15 PM
    0 responses
    23 views
    0 likes
    Last Post TheRealMorford  
    Started by Mindset, 02-28-2026, 06:16 AM
    0 responses
    51 views
    0 likes
    Last Post Mindset
    by Mindset
     
    Working...
    X